Puerto Bacuchi is a pass in Banámichi, Sonora and has an elevation of 1,615 metres. Puerto Bacuchi is situated nearby to the locality El Cantil, as well as near El Cajón Colorado.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Pass with an elevation of 1,615 metres
- Categories: mountain pass and landform
- Location: Banámichi, Sonora, Northern Mexico, Mexico, North America
